Outcome Document on Legal Tech Use Cases Presented in IndoCon 2023 [AISTANDARDIO-RDC-0002-2024]

The R&D Committee of ISAIL had hosted two virtual committee sessions on November 22, 2023, inviting companies and their representatives to demonstrate their use cases in artificial intelligence and legal technology as a part of the Indian Conference on Artificial Intelligence and Law, 2023.

The Indian Society of Artificial Intelligence and Law is an artificial intelligence industry forum, founded by Abhivardhan in 2018. Our mission as a not-for-profit industry forum for the analytics & AI industry in India is to promote responsible development of artificial intelligence and its standardisation in India.

Since 2022, the research operations of the Society have been subsumed under VLiGTA® by Indic Pacific Legal Research.

ISAIL has supported two independent journals, namely - the Indic Journal of International Law and the Indian Journal of Artificial Intelligence and Law. It also supports an independent media and community initiative - The Bharat Pacific.

ISAIL’s India-centric AI policy documentations, community-centric initiatives, and contributions to AI standardisation in India have been acknowledged by the Council of Europe, quite recently.
